R-Studio for Mac is powerful and cost-effective data recovery software for Apple lovers. R-Studio for Mac is specially designed for Mac OS environment and recovers files from HFS/HFS+ (Macintosh), FAT/NTFS (Windows), exFAT(WinMobile, Windows Vista and Windows 7) UFS1/UFS2 (FreeBSD/OpenBSD/NetBSD/Solaris) and Ext2FS/3FS/4FS (Linux) local and network disks even if partitions are formatted, damaged or deleted. Additional file recovery algorithm increases the quality of file recovery and recovers files not recognized in file system metadata. Dynamic disk and RAID (including RAID 6) are supported as well as recovering encrypted files, compressed files and alternative data streams. Files and file systems structures (NTFS/FAT boot sectors, MFT file record, MBR, LDM structures, etc) can be viewed and edited in the professional disk hex editor. In addition to byte to byte copy of any object visible in the Drives panel, smart copy of partitions and hard drives with size and offset adjustment is available. Extended Viewer Plugin allows viewing a content of the found files to estimate recovery chances prior to purchasing.
